Book Getting Solutions inside Tx

Lease to possess possessions sounds exactly like what it is: property which you rent getting a flat time period (constantly two years or more). After the go out tickets you order our house downright.

Constantly, you are going to need to shell out a prospective alternatives fee on start of a rental-to-very own package. You could consider this as being similar to a down payment into home financing.

Next, a fraction of your monthly book payment goes to the main cost of purchasing the house because book https://servicecashadvance.com/installment-loans-al/oxford/ keeps run out.

After a rental-to-own bargain, you’ve kept to locate more bad credit home loan Tx capital. That is why people timid from this 1. Yet not, it could be very good for people who require couple of years roughly to fix the borrowing from the bank in advance of investing a complete-go out mortgage of any sort.

Cosigner toward home financing

Otherwise qualify for a poor credit home loan when you look at the Tx is to obtain a cosigner and you’re shopping for another alternative that will allow that purchase a property now, you can imagine looking for anyone to cosign the mortgage to you.

Lenders usually check out the cosigner’s credit rating along with the very own before mode new regards to a prospective financial, usually ultimately causing so much more good terminology.

Although not, thus brand new cosigner was agreeing and then make people costs you neglect to spend. Which is a huge union, very make sure that your cosigner are somebody you can trust.

And you can, perhaps furthermore, make sure your top family member or friend knows exactly what exactly they are getting into after they cosign your loan.

Less than perfect credit Lenders Inside the Texas Just after Bankruptcy proceeding

After you seek bankruptcy relief, they greatly has an effect on what you can do locate a home loan about upcoming. In most urban centers within the Colorado, you simply cannot make an application for a normal mortgage for those who have registered having bankruptcy proceeding in the last seven many years. But it is possible to make post-case of bankruptcy homeownership possible faster than simply you to definitely.

You’re able to submit an application for an enthusiastic FHA loan, and that very homebuyers should be able to would. You are able to do so merely three-years once you declare case of bankruptcy instead of the complete eight. And if you are one of the few that qualified to receive a beneficial Virtual assistant financing, you can apply in just one or two!
